Restaurant Spotlight 🍽

Mei Thai sits right on Old Trolley Road, and from the outside you’d never guess how many different flavor lanes the kitchen actually covers. Once you step in, the warm lighting and neat layout make it easy to settle in—whether you’re there for a quiet dinner or bringing a small group.
The menu reflects a blend of Thai, Filipino, and Japanese influences, which gives the whole experience a choose-your-own-adventure feel. You can start with something familiar like Pad Thai or curry and then pivot into chicken inasal, lumpia, or a roll from the sushi bar without it feeling out of place. It’s one of the few spots in the area where you can build a meal across three cuisines and have each dish feel like it belongs.

What stands out most is how bold the flavors are. The Thai dishes bring real aromatics—basil, chili, lemongrass—without being overwhelming. The Filipino plates are comforting and richly seasoned, and the sushi offerings add a lighter, fresher balance if you’re mixing and matching. It’s the kind of menu that encourages sharing just so you can taste more of it.
Service tends to move at an easy pace, and the staff walks that line of helping when needed but giving you room to enjoy the meal. Whether you’re asking for spice adjustments or exploring dishes you haven’t tried before, the team handles it with a sense of ease that makes the whole experience feel smooth.

If you want something different from the usual dinner spots in Summerville, Mei Thai earns a try. It’s versatile enough for a weeknight meal, interesting enough for a date night, and varied enough that everyone at the table can land on something they’re excited about.
